Arsenal is vying for the Premier League title, having already spent €220 million this summer, with an additional £60 million to pursue Eze.

Arteta has not secured a Premier League title during his time at Arsenal, and the last three seasons have seen him finish as a runner-up. This summer, he aims to build a squad that can compete for the championship. The transfer of the Portuguese league's top scorer, Yorkres, is confirmed and just needs to be officially announced. As per Italian transfer expert Romano, the total fee is €73.6 million, comprising a fixed amount of €63.5 million plus an additional €10 million in performance-related bonuses.

It’s surprising to realize that Arsenal's spending on new signings this summer has reached €220 million, detailed as follows:

  • Yorkres: €63.5 million.
  • Mosquera: €15 million.
  • Madueke: €55.4 million.
  • Zubimendi: €70 million.
  • Norgaard: €11.6 million.
  • Kepa: €5.8 million.

Arsenal's total expenditure on signings this summer has already surpassed €220 million, excluding the add-ons. In addition, Arsenal is pursuing Eze, with an anticipated transfer fee reaching £60 million. If, after completing this squad, Arsenal still fails to win the Premier League title next season, Arteta's position may become precarious. Given that Arsenal's squad is already top-tier and has not secured a significant trophy, the blame would likely fall on the manager.
